Yoshitane Soma is the 16th head of the Soma clan, lord of Odaka Castle, and the son of Moritane Soma. Although he fought the Date for years, he was allowed to keep his land upon surrendering.
Role in Games[]
In Samurai Warriors 4, Yoshitane is initially found at Hitotoribashi, targeting Shigezane Date alongside his father. At Koriyama, Yoshitane ambushes the Date forces inside Odemori Castle alongside the Ashina forces. The expansion has him appear at Kaneyama Castle during Masamune's debut in Oshu alongside Magoichi.
Historical Information[]
As the 16th head of the Soma clan, Yoshitane fought against the Date in numerous battles before eventually surrendering in 1589. When Date Masamune submitted himself to Toyotomi Hideyoshi, he followed suit and his domain in Mutsu was restored. However, his land was confiscated as a result of his failute to respond to Ieyasu's call to arms during the Battle of Sekigahara. The Soma clan only regained their prestige after Tokugawa Iemitsu's birth. Yoshitane was succeeded by his son Toshitane.
